Copy your client.ovpn config file from the server into 'C://Programs/OpenVPN/config/', now right click on the icon from openvpn in window's context menu and select "connect".
from openvpn-install.
so the client.ovpn is a certificate file? Thanks.
from openvpn-install.
It's every file you need for connecting crushed into one single file which can be used by openvpn to connect to your server.
from openvpn-install.
Awesome thanks. Turned out I needed to use the openVPN app, which had an import option for that file. Thanks for the quick reply.
